> > I tried an NFS install but the error message (from memory) indicated
> > that I had not exported the directory appropriately.  To what
> > should /etc/exports be pointed for an installing computer to find it?
> 
> My relevant line looks like this:
> /mnt/centos               192.168.0.0/255.255.255.0(ro,no_root_squash,sync)
> 
> You may need to change the network parameters...  /mnt/centos is where
> I mounted the CD iso.
> 
> >From (failing) memory, i supplied th IP of the server, and /mnt/centos
> as the path at install time, and it went from there.
> 
> iptables might be an issue - you may have to allow nfs through
> whatever firewall you're using.
